Roof lantern prices in the UK can vary depending on several factors such as the size, material, and design of the lantern In general, larger roof lanterns with custom designs and high-quality materials tend to be more expensive than standard-sized models made from basic materials To give you a better idea of what to expect when it comes to roof lantern prices in the UK, here is a breakdown of the typical costs involved.

Size plays a crucial role in determining the price of a roof lantern Larger roof lanterns that cover a greater surface area will inevitably cost more than smaller models As such, it is essential to consider the dimensions of your roof and the amount of natural light that you want to let into your living space when deciding on the size of your roof lantern On average, you can expect to pay anywhere from £1,500 to £7,000 for a standard-sized roof lantern, with larger custom-made models costing significantly more.

Additionally, the material of the roof lantern can also impact the price Roof lanterns are typically made from either uPVC, aluminium, or timber Each material has its own set of advantages and drawbacks, which may influence your decision For example, uPVC is a cost-effective option that requires minimal maintenance, while aluminium is durable and offers excellent thermal efficiency Timber, on the other hand, is a classic choice that adds a touch of warmth and beauty to your home but may require more upkeep over time roof lantern prices uk. Prices for roof lanterns made from uPVC typically start at around £1,500, while aluminium and timber models can cost anywhere from £2,000 to £10,000 or more depending on the size and design.

Furthermore, the design of the roof lantern can also impact the overall price Standard roof lanterns with a simple square or rectangular shape are generally more affordable than custom-made designs with intricate patterns or curved edges If you are looking for a unique and stylish roof lantern that complements the architecture of your home, be prepared to pay a premium for custom designs Prices for bespoke roof lanterns can range from £2,000 to £15,000 or more, depending on the complexity of the design and the materials used.

In addition to the size, material, and design of the roof lantern, installation costs should also be factored into your budget The cost of installation will depend on various factors such as the complexity of the roof structure, the accessibility of the roof, and the location of your property On average, you can expect to pay between £500 and £2,000 for professional installation of a roof lantern in the UK It is essential to hire a reputable and experienced contractor to ensure that the installation is done correctly and to avoid any potential issues in the future.
